A sensitive treatment of the fate that awaits girls and women in India, especially those born into lower castes.

A beautiful, luminous children's adaptation of a portion of the international bestseller The Braid. Young Lalita and her mother Smita are born into the lowest, or "Untouchable" caste: the Dalits. They must travel across India in an astonishing and magnificently illustrated tale of life, rebellion, faith, and hope that introduces readers to such issues as social class, the plight of women, and access to education.
